Package: php-zeroc-ice Version: 3.2.1-2 Severity: important I installed mumble-server/sid, which depends on mumble-server-web and thus on php-zeroc-ice. The installation of lighttpd on this machine ceased to function - investigation revealed that it was unable to spawn PHP FCGI workers. Attempting to start php5-cgi from the commandline resulted in the following error:
